hrtimer: Fix kerneldoc syntax for 'struct hrtimer_cpu_base' The '/**' sequence marks the start of a structure description. Add the missing second asterisk. While at it adapt the ordering of the struct members to the struct definition and document the purpose of expires_next more precisely.
